Latest Patents

Kuwata's latest patents include a method for measuring a component of a biological fluid while reducing the effect of interfering substances. This method involves converting the component to be measured into hydrogen peroxide through an enzymatic reaction. The formed hydrogen peroxide is then reacted with an oxidative-coloring chromogen in the presence of a peroxidase, allowing for the measurement of absorbance in the colored reaction solution. This innovative approach is particularly useful in clinical diagnosis, especially when bilirubin is present.

Another significant patent is the sphingomyelin measurement method using sequential phospholipase D reactions. This method provides a simple and accurate way to measure sphingomyelin in a sample. It involves reacting the sample with specific enzymes and measuring the resultant hydrogen peroxide, which allows for precise sphingomyelin quantification.
